Vinicius Gomes

São Paulo born and New York based guitarist/composer, Vinicius Gomes explores the dialogue between modern jazz and Brazilian music, as registered on his debut album, "Resiliência" (2017-Blackstream), "Changes" (2020-FreshSound), in collaboration with spanish saxophonist Santi De la Rubia featuring drummer Jorge Rossy and bassist Doug Weiss and the most recent release "HOME" (2022-Greenleaf) in duo with Korean singer Song Yi Jeon.

​Vinicius has performed with his own projects and as a collaborator in important venues such as Dizzy's Club (NY), Smalls (NY), Jazz Gallery (NY), Bimhuis (Amsterdam), Bellas Artes (Mexico City), National Sawdust (NY), Blue Note (NY), Duc Des Lombards (Paris), Sunset Sunside (Paris), JazzStation (Brussels), B-Flat (Berlin), Zigzag (Berlin) Bird’s Eye (Basel), Porgy And Bess (Vienna), and others.
